Population Overview

Fremont village is a small community located in Wisconsin, within Waupaca County. The total population is 592. It ranks as the 504th most populous out of 807 cities and towns in Wisconsin.

Age Demographics

The median age in Fremont village is 48.0 years. This is 20% higher than the state median of 40.1 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Fremont village is $71,875. This is 5% lower than the state median of $75,670.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 8% lower. The poverty rate stands at 13.2%. This is 25% higher than the state poverty rate of 10.6%. The unemployment rate is 0.0%. This is 100% lower than the state rate of 3.3%. The median home value is $210,200. Housing costs are 15% lower than the state median of $247,400.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 2.9x, Fremont village is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 72.6%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 7% higher than the state average of 67.9%.

Race & Ethnicity

Fremont village has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 91.9% of all residents.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 7.9%.

Education

24.9%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 24% lower than the state rate of 32.8%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 89.9%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Fremont village, Wisconsin is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Wisconsin state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 807 Census-designated places in Wisconsin.
